The Sacrifice Mechanism Is the Basis of Civilization

The need to find a scapegoat was at the outset of civilization. It's all related to the notion of mimetic desire, where everyone wants what they can't have. The scapegoad mechanism was a way to re start the process and to avoid going out of control. But murder is not the basis of culture. Marriage is.
